Switch to reusable bags

We go grocery shopping at least a few times per week. Depending on the number of items we buy, we can use up to 10 plastic bags. According to dripfina.com, when you calculate the numbers on plastic bags per year, a single household can use between 500 and 1,000 bags per year. Those numbers are scary since most of the bags we decide to throw away will not get recycled and they will pollute the earth and the oceans.
If you want to make your impact and protect the environment, you should switch to reusable bags. They are durable, will not get damaged by use, you can put a lot of items in them, plus they are easy to store. Many people choose them because they are inexpensive and even if they tear, they can be recycled.
Keep a few of them in your vehicle and use them every time you go grocery shopping. In addition to doing your part of waste management, you will even save some money.

Composting
What do you do with the food leftovers? Do you just throw away the peel of fruits and vegetables? What do you do with the leftover coffee beans? If you have a yard, or even if you just own some plants, you can help them out and reduce the garbage in your home!
When you have some food scraps, then you can put them in a container and wait for them to become compost. You can even just blend them and combine them with the soil you use for your plants. The compost will provide a lot of vitamins and minerals to your plants and they will be healthier than ever. This type of compost is great to keep pests away and the plants will grow faster and stronger.

Reusable containers

How do you store the leftovers? Do you always use a different container that is for one use only, and do you use plastic wrap to make sure they don’t go bad?
There are so many containers that you can reuse, so you can eliminate the waste that it comes with foil wraps. You can even get some adjustable lids that you can put on the original container, so you can keep the food fresh without adding any foil or plastic wrap. If you need to store your leftovers, it is better to choose an environment-friendly packaging that you can just wash and reuse again.
Once again, this will also save you money, because you won’t have to buy new containers or foil every time you want to keep something in the fridge.

Eliminate single packaging

When you decide to switch to buying in bulk, you will reduce so much waste. If you’ve noticed, most of the single packaging products are wrapped in too many materials, and they are double in size compared to the item itself.
So, when you need to purchase something that you use daily or weekly, it is better to invest in getting the product in bulk than one thing only. This will not only reduce waste, but it will also save you money. Single packaging products are always more expensive than buying two, three, or ten of the same items.
Try not to use plastic cups, utensils, or plates, even when you are on vacation. These things usually cannot be recycled and they will not degrade for decades. If you have to use them, don’t throw them away, just wash them and use them again. If you are throwing a party, and you have to choose something that can be thrown away after use, it is better to opt for good-quality paper cups. They won’t get damaged by the beverage, and they are not going to pollute the environment. Another great thing about paper cups is that they can be used as a compost afterward.
When buying fruits and vegetables, don’t buy things that are already stored in containers and pre-wrapped. All of these foods have natural protection and they don’t need to be wrapped in foil. When you pay attention to the little things, you can notice how much of a difference you can make.
